  9. Finally made it home! What a great week! Great convention. Let me get back to the 2010 convention for a moment and then I'll share my thoughts about ZCON09. The ZCCA national convention 2010 is slated to begin Wednesday, July 28th and continue through Sunday, August 1st. The car show is Saturday, July 31st on the front lawn of Nissan headquarters. This convention will be a 40th anniversary celebration of the Z with Nissan. Nissan NA is talking about bringing ten "heritage cars" from Zama. The website should be up real soon - www.ZCON2010.com And Nissan's website is going to have information. I'm starting tp post pictures in the gallery.
